Outline of Final Research Achievements |
To deepen our understanding of protein folding, which is still difficult to predict, we have been trying to establish an experimental system for in vitro protein folding evolution using peptide tags and a nano-LC-tandem mass spectrometer. We have designed about 100 types of quantifiable peptide tags, investigated and optimized the measurement conditions using a cell-free protein synthesis system, and attempted folding evolution experiments of model proteins but have not yet succeeded in doing so. The problems are the high cost of measurement and the inefficiency of sample preparation and measurement. Some of these problems are expected to be improved by devising experimental conditions, and we would like to challenge these problems if possible.
